Typhoon Odette devastated Central Philippines in late December, resulting in damages in infrastructure and agriculture, and disruption in vaccination efforts. COVID-19 cases have surged again due to the Omicron variant. The authorities responded by raising the public alert level a notch higher, limiting mobility in many localities.
